1.6 Managing Print Jobs from the Client
Users can monitor and manage their own print jobs from their workstations using the CUPS
management utility included with your Linux distribution. GNOME users can use the printer folder
in Computer > Control Center > Printers, and KDE users can use the KJobViewer by clicking the
main menu button > Tools > Printing > KJobViewer (Print Jobs).
NOTE: If the iPrint server is busy when your installed printer attempts to communicate, CUPS
moves the printer into an error state and holds all print jobs. To release print jobs, use a printer
management utility to restart the printer.
1.7 Using iprntcmd
The Linux iPrint Client includes the iprntcmd utility that lets you install printers, print test pages,
and upload drivers to a driver store from a terminal prompt. The iprntcmd utility is located in /
opt/novell/iprint/bin/iprntcmd.
Use the following parameters when executing the iprntcmd command:
